RockHaven Children’s Services Inc. is a Treatment Foster Care Agency that has been working closely with Children’s Aid Societies within Ontario for the past 22 years, providing family-based care to children and youth. RockHaven is currently looking for Foster Parents to provide care for 1-4 children/youth in their own home.

Each Foster Parent is provided with full orientation, regular training sessions and 24/7 support to ensure the children/youth in your care have a safe, stable and nurturing home environment. Foster Parents are provided with 24hour on call support, competitive compensation, paid relief, 2 weeks of paid vacation as well as the support of a CYC worker.

RockHaven will train the applicant to ensure they have all of the skills and knowledge in order to care for children/youth in their care. Having experience working with children who display challenging behaviours is an asset.

All applicants must be able to provide a clear vulnerable sector police check as well as a satisfactory CAS background check. You must have a valid Class G driver’s licence as well as your own transportation. A home study will also be complete as part of the process to becoming a Foster Parent.

POSITION

Full Time Foster Parent to Children and Youth. The applicant may be, (single, a couple or partners).

SUMMARY

RockHaven Children’s Services Treatment Foster Care (TFC) provides a safe, stable and nurturing home environment for children and youth who have emotional or behavioral needs. We are a family-based residential treatment program that allows the child to experience healthy parent-to-child relationships in an environment that promotes growth and healing.

We are seeking Foster Parents who are able to provide care for 1- 4 children/youth in your home. Support from a CYC based on each child/youths individual needs. 24/7, 365 day on call support. Competitive and generous compensation that is a tax free per diem.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ES

· Maintain a clean and organized home providing nutritious meals and a warm, welcoming environment

· Provide care and supervision to meet the child/youth’s needs and collaboratively work with RockHaven and other community resources in achieving the treatment goals set out by RockHaven/Children’s Aid Societies.

· Complete thorough daily logs and documentation

· Liaison with management and on call to report any concerns with the youth in your care

· Attend regular and/or special medical, optical, and dental appointments of the child/youth

· To share with RockHaven all information about the child's progress or difficulties in his/her daily living, health or adjustment to the home, school, or community

· Medication administration and monitoring

· Document important moments in the child/youth's life

· Responsible for the child/youth’s transportation

· Teach life skills and social skill development

· Professional communication with co-workers/foster parents, CYC’s, social workers

· Encourage and supervise school attendance, attend teacher conferences and keep your supervisor within RockHaven up to date regarding any educational needs and/or changes

· Support and encourage the child/youth’s participation in school, leisure time, community activities and his/her own interests

· Attend all case planning conferences and administrative case reviews to offer input regarding the child/youth in your home

· To engage with the child/youth’s biological family as directed to encourage a positive relationship and facilitate reunification

· To respect final decisions made by RockHaven/Children’s Aid Society or court if they can be validated as in the best interest of the child/youth

· To comply with all legislation, regulations and Provincial Standards concerning foster care and children/youth in care

· Adhere to all Ministry and RockHaven requested trainings to support both personal and professional development

· Adhere to RockHaven’s Policies and Procedures/Program Description as set out by the Ministry.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S, K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, ABILITIES

· Experience working with children and youth who may have emotional, physical, trauma, behavioural and social challenges would be an asset

· Educational background in working with special need children/youth and/or social services is an asset

· Must be adaptable and flexible to change for any unplanned situations that may arise

· Strong decision-making skills and be able to effectively problem solve

· Behavioural management skills an asset

· Excellent interpersonal, communication and documentation skills

· Strong ability to build supportive and productive relationships with all parties involved

· Have a genuine care and concern for the child/youth’s well-being and a desire to make a difference in their life

· Excellent organizational skills

· Must have a valid class G driver’s licence, driver’s abstract, vulnerable sector police check, CAS background check, medical

Successful applicant will be provided with all necessary training (CPR/First Aid, NVCI, PRIDE, Cultural Competency Training, TIC training) and orientation. Applicants will also have a home study complete.
